Registered parishioners who wish their child baptized at St. Viator are required to participate in our TWO-SESSION BAPTISMAL PROGRAM. Parents will complete the Baptism Registration Form during the second class. Expectant parents are also welcome to attend this program.
- Session 1 is an informal meeting with other parents wishing to have their child baptized. This is a time for parents to exchange with one another their ideas and practices of how they live the Christian principles in their every day lives. Parents also have the opportunity to explore a deeper understanding of Baptism and its sacramental meaning.
- Session 2 looks at the Baptismal ceremony and its many symbols and the place of the sacrament in the life of the Church.
